MORENO VALLEY, Calif. - Representatives from the Bureau of Land Management (BLM) and the U.S. Marine Corps will host a Resource Management Group meeting on April 2, 2016 from 10:00 a.m. to 12:00 p.m. The meeting will be held at the Lucerne Valley Community Center, 33187 Highway 247 East, Lucerne Valley, Calif.

The purpose of the meeting is to communicate the Marine Corps' plans to conduct a large-scale exercise August 1-31, 2016 that will include training in the congressionally established shared use area of the Johnson Valley Off-Highway Vehicle Recreation Area. Information concerning temporary land closures and public safety related to then exercise will be discussed. All members of the public are welcome to attend.
